Pianist, arranger. A superior arranger and good accompanist most famous for providing the hit arrangement of "Wade In The Water" for the Ramsey Lewis group. Simmons worked in the '50s and '60s for several vocalists, among them Dakota Staton, Ernestine Anderson and Carmen McRae, and has been a regular pianist for Joe Williams since 1979.
